Certificate: Medical Family Therapy/Therapist

A program that prepares individuals to work with patients and their families who are experiencing emotional, physical, relational and spiritual difficulties related to acute and chronic illnesses. Includes instruction in cultural context, ethics, family dynamics, family therapy, gender, human development, marriage counseling, psychopathology, research design and methods, sexuality, and systems thinking.
